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: Prudential Financial, Inc.
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: June 12, 2012
Event: Authorization of a new share repurchase program.
Key Financial Metrics
This filing does not report rev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ity metrics. The document focuses exclusively on a capital allocation decision.
Material Changes
The Board of Directors authorized the repurchase of up to $1.0 billion of the Company's outstanding Common Stock. This authorization is effective for the period from July 1, 2012, through June 30, 2013.
Guidance, Outlook, and Management Commentary
- Execution Strategy: The timing and amount of repurchases will be determined by management based on market conditions and other considerations.
- Methods: Repurchases may be executed in the open market, through derivative or accelerated repurchase transactions, via other negotiated transactions, or through plans designed to comply with Rule 10b5-1(c).
- Outlook: No specific financial guidance or earnings outlook is provided in this filing.
